| Along The Continental Divide The Continental Divide follows the crest of the Rocky Mountains for over 3,000 miles through four states of the American West: New Mexico, Colorado, Wyoming and Montana. Rain falling east of the Divide eventually flows into the Atlantic Ocean, while precipitation falling to the west finds its way to the Pacific. | Gale Worth Biography After high school, Gale Worth joined the Army and was stationed in France for over two years. He bought a bicycle, and then an old French car that he fixed up well enough to drive through the countryside and villages of Central France, where he learned to appreciate a culture different than his own. Back home, he went to college and became a Forest Ranger. After four years in the forest, he made a career switch to public television where he produced educational and public service programs for the next 22 years. Now free to set out on new journeys, Gale explores our fascinating world with a camera, sharing his adventures and discoveries with audiences everywhere. |
